How much does it cost to rent a home in Katy?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Katy 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,457 | $1,475 | $4,800 |
| Katy 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,161 | $1,570 | $6,250 |
| Katy 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,690 | $750 | $10,000+ |
| Katy 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,896 | $2,100 | $10,000+ |
| Katy 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,069 | $2,850 | $6,700 |
| Katy 7 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$6,000 | $6,000 | $6,000 |

What type of rentals are currently available in Katy?
There are currently 231 Apartments for Rent in Katy, TX with pricing that ranges from $475 to $5,605. There are also 1334 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Katy ranging from $700 to $12,500.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Katy?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Katy ranges from $700 to $12,500 with an average monthly rent of $3,065.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Katy?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Katy range from $1,226 to $5,605,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,570 to $6,250.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$750 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$2,022.
